CANCELED: VocalEssence Presents: The Aeolians
This concert is canceled VocalEssence is canceling the February 28 performance with The Aeolians of Oakwood University at North High School in Minneapolis in an effort to limit exposure to the high levels of community spread of the coronavirus variant. The Aeolians will still be with us for WITNESS: Rejoice! on Sunday, March 6 at Orchestra Hall in Minneapolis. CONCERT: WITNESS 2022: Rejoice!
TICKETS ARE STILL AVAILABLE! Affirm Black joy and resilience The Aeolians, a world-renowned choir from Oakwood University in Huntsville, Alabama, an Historically Black College and University, are giving us so many reasons to “Rejoice.” Named the “2017 Choir of the World” at the World Choir Games, The Aeolians inspire audiences to stand up and cheer for more, whether singing the music of Bach, spirituals, or 21st century masterpieces. TOUR: Bob Dylan Revisited Tour, Detroit Lakes, MN
VocalEssence sings the music of Bob Dylan Bob Dylan’s timeless music has been covered by everyone from Jimi Hendrix to the Kronos Quartet. Now it’s time to add a choir to the list. Join VocalEssence singers as they reimagine Dylan in The Times They Are A-Changin’: The Words and Music of Bob Dylan, commissioned in honor of his 2016 Nobel Prize in Literature and arranged by Steve Hackman. CONCERT: Sabathani Vintage Voices
THE Sabathani vintage voices PRESENT "SO MANY REASONS TO REJOICE!" The Sabathani Vintage Voices will perform a spring concert centered around the theme of "So Many Reasons to Rejoice!" The singers will share messages of hope for the future and celebrate our resilience in overcoming the many hardships brought on by the COVID-19 and racial pandemics impacting our communities.
